Comprehensive Guide to SEVIS Transfer Form

What is the S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form?

The S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form is a crucial document used by students in the United States to initiate the transfer of their SEVIS record from Monmouth College to another academic institution. This form serves to officially communicate the student's intent to relocate their educational journey, ensuring compliance with immigration regulations. Understanding key terms such as SEVIS record and Designated School Official (DSO) is essential when navigating this process.
Transferring a SEVIS record is significant as it affects a student's immigration status and access to necessary resources while attending a new school. Students must familiarize themselves with the SEVIS transfer form to ensure a smooth transition between institutions, aiding in the maintenance of their legal status as they pursue their education in a new environment.

What Happens After You Submit the S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form

Once the S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form is submitted, the processing of the transfer begins. Institutions will handle the transfer of records according to the specified protocols. Students should follow up to confirm the successful submission and track the status of their application after a few days.
If issues arise during the transfer process, such as rejections or requests for additional information, students should not hesitate to contact their current DSO or the receiving school’s admissions office for guidance. Proactive communication can help resolve potential hurdles swiftly.

International students currently enrolled at Monmouth College are eligible to use the S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form to transfer their SEVIS records to another academic institution.
It's advisable to complete the S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form at least 30 days prior to your intended transfer date to ensure a smooth transition and avoid any delays.
The completed S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form can be submitted directly to the designated school official at your receiving institution or via email. Ensure to check with them for any specific submission guidelines.
You typically need to provide your student ID, SEVIS ID, and the details of the receiving institution. Always check the specific requirements of your new school for additional documents.
Avoid incomplete fields, incorrect signatures, and ensure you have the right details about the receiving institution. Double-check everything to prevent delays in processing your transfer.
Processing times can vary, but generally, expect 1-2 weeks for confirmation. It's advised to monitor your SEVIS record and stay in touch with both institutions during the process.
Submitting an incorrectly filled SEVIS Transfer Authorization Form can lead to delays in your transfer, potentially impacting your immigration status. Always ensure accuracy and completeness.
